ok , just in case some one comes here and asks that these games don't run on (xbox) xba latest version..

this is how you make them run:
once u select the game leave every option on default, don't know if these games require a real clock option like the other ones, ruby n sapphire, you can enable that option on just to make sure. If you like to use gba bios, you can set that up to to which ever bios you want 1 or 2. But, don't turn on this option:
Remove GBA Intros

leave it on NO, if you put it to YES, you'll get a nice white screen
